Stuart Kaplan, who published STUDENT SURVIVAL on his own, saw
my letter in TOYS AND NOVELTIES and called to tell me of his game. The
company he is working for is buying a company for him to run as a
game company. He realizes that his original game is a MONOPOLY imitation, but he figured it was timely. He wants more thought-provoking games for
the new company, however. Told him that I evaluate games and also that I
create them. He said he'd arrange to have me bring some to shore him.
Told him about AIRLINE but he said it might be limited in appeal. He
said that foreign representatives of his parent company were sending
him games from abroad. I told him I'd like to see them sometime. He
said that after they had decided on licensing agreements I probably
could be arranged.
